void-linux / void-packages

The Void source packages collection
https://voidlinux.org
Other
2.5k stars 2.11k forks source link

Package request: ueberzugpp #45368

Open atk opened 1 year ago

atk commented 1 year ago

Package name

ueberzugpp

Package homepage

https://github.com/jstkdng/ueberzugpp/tree/master

Description

Shows images in a terminal, replaces the now unmaintained ueberzug.

Does the requested package meet the package requirements?

Compiled

Is the requested package released?

Yes

tranzystorekk commented 1 year ago

https://github.com/tranzystorek-io/void-packages/blob/ueberzugpp/srcpkgs/ueberzugpp/template up for grabs, with some notes though:

ibhagwan commented 4 months ago

@tranzystorekk, with https://github.com/void-linux/void-packages/issues/45679 closed it might be worthwhile to revisit this issue, I wanted to test and potentially PR ueberzugpp but it seems your fork was deleted, perhaps I can save some time if you still have the template?

tranzystorekk commented 4 months ago

I'm afraid I removed the branch as part of some clean up and I don't have a copy anywhere :/

ibhagwan commented 4 months ago

I'm afraid I removed the branch as part of some clean up and I don't have a copy anywhere :/

Is there any change you can quickly recreate it or have any pointers how to deal with downloadable depedencies?

I can most likely create this but it would take while for me to read through the void-packages manual.

tranzystorekk commented 4 months ago

If you mean cli11 I simply packaged it as well in that branch

ibhagwan commented 4 months ago

If you mean cli11 I simply packaged it as well in that branch

What about nlohmann-json?

tranzystorekk commented 4 months ago

that's packaged in void as json-c++

ibhagwan commented 4 months ago

If anyone is intrested I was able to package ueberzugpp, my branch contains 2 packages:

https://github.com/void-linux/void-packages/compare/master...ibhagwan:void-packages:master